Hannah Stein however had been told that Parkerville a small town in Lancaster County Pennsylvania was an exception a safe peaceful place. In 2005 Hannah's idyllic illusion was shattered when her neighbor a teenage boy named Matthew Baker killed his family and raped his cousin. Now fourteen years later Baker suddenly protests that he is innocent. Could this possibly be true? It is the summer of 2019 and Hannah a Jewish English professor is hunting for an unusual topic that will intrigue three apathetic students. Hannah suggests that her students join her and examine an old murder case that has haunted her for years. From their research her students will glean material for their research papers and Hannah hopes she will find answers to her nagging questions. But not everyone thinks this investigation is a good idea. Ethan Hannah's handsome neighbor wants Hannah to stop meddling with the past and concentrate on him. However Hannah a widow in her forties cannot abandon her probe just to please a man. As the inquiry into the Baker case proceeds the violence swirling around Hannah and her students escalates pulling them down dangerous paths. In addition the Baker investigation resurrects dark childhood memories that cannot be ignored. When Hannah was five years old she witnessed her mother's murder but was unable to identify the killer.
